Penn State Health Hershey Medical Center is seeking a Polysomnographic Technologist - Sleep Studies to perform comprehensive polysomnographic testing, analysis, and scoring under the Medical Director's supervision. The role includes mentoring staff and supporting department goals.
The position is full-time evenings at the Hershey Medical Center campus, with a 7:00 PM to 7:30 AM schedule and a 0.90 FTE. Candidates must have 18 months of sleep tech experience and be a Board-certified RPSGT.

SUMMARY OF POSITION:
Responsible for performing comprehensive polysomnographic testing, analysis, and associated interventions plus scoring under the general supervision of the Medical Director (MD, PhD, DO). Responsible for serving as a preceptor and mentor to staff.
